A well-planned pescetarian diet, which includes fish and seafood alongside plant-based foods, can be exceptionally healthy, providing high-quality protein and beneficial omega-3 fatty acids. However, the exclusion of red meat and poultry means that special attention must be paid to certain nutrients that are less abundant or less bioavailable in plant-based sources. A deeper understanding of these potential gaps and how to address them is crucial for long-term health.
Potential Deficiencies in a Pescetarian Diet
Iron
One of the most common deficiencies for pescetarians is iron, particularly for women of menstruating age. The primary reason for this is that red meat is the richest source of heme iron, which is the most readily absorbed form of iron in the body. While fish and shellfish do contain iron, and plants offer non-heme iron, their absorption rates are lower. Factors like phytic acid in plant foods and oxalic acid in some greens can further inhibit non-heme iron absorption.
To increase iron intake and absorption, pescetarians should focus on consuming iron-rich plant foods in combination with sources of vitamin C. Seafood like oysters, clams, and canned sardines with bones are also good options for boosting iron levels.
Vitamin B12
Vitamin B12 is almost exclusively found in animal products, including fish, meat, dairy, and eggs. While pescetarians often consume fish, relying solely on seafood may not be enough to meet daily requirements, especially if other animal products like dairy or eggs are restricted. A long-term deficiency can lead to nerve damage, fatigue, and other neurological issues.
For those who don't eat dairy or eggs, fortified foods such as cereals, nutritional yeast, and plant milks are important sources. Regular consumption of vitamin-B12-rich fish like salmon, sardines, and tuna, or shellfish such as clams and mussels, can also help. Supplementation may be necessary to ensure adequate intake, especially for older adults or those with limited dietary sources.
Zinc
Zinc is a vital mineral for immune function, wound healing, and growth. The most bioavailable sources of zinc are from red meats. While fish and seafood contain zinc, they do not have the same levels as red meat. As with iron, zinc absorption from plant foods like legumes and whole grains can be hindered by phytates.
Pescatarians can boost their zinc intake by prioritizing shellfish, such as oysters, which are an exceptional source. Other options include legumes (lentils, chickpeas), nuts (cashews, pecans), seeds (pumpkin, sesame), and fortified cereals.
Calcium and Vitamin D
For pescetarians who also avoid dairy and eggs, maintaining adequate calcium and vitamin D levels can be a concern. Vitamin D is crucial for bone health and proper calcium absorption. While sun exposure is a key source, dietary intake is also important.
Fatty fish like salmon and sardines are good sources of both vitamin D and calcium (if bones are consumed). Other strategies include consuming calcium-fortified plant milks and cereals, tofu prepared with calcium sulfate, and leafy greens like kale and bok choy. Regular, moderate sun exposure and supplementation are also valid options.

Strategies for a Balanced Pescetarian Diet
-
Prioritize Seafood Variety: Don't just stick to one type of fish. Incorporate a wide variety of fish and shellfish to broaden your nutrient intake. Fatty fish like salmon and sardines are rich in omega-3s, while shellfish like oysters and clams offer substantial iron and zinc. Be mindful of mercury levels by choosing smaller, lower-mercury fish.
-
Enhance Plant-Based Absorption: Combine iron-rich plant foods with vitamin C sources to boost absorption. For example, have a spinach salad with bell peppers, or lentils with tomatoes. Soaking and cooking legumes and grains can also reduce phytates and enhance mineral absorption.
-
Use Fortified Foods: Many store-bought products, including breakfast cereals, plant milks, and nutritional yeast, are fortified with B vitamins, calcium, and iron. Checking labels and making fortified foods a regular part of your diet can help fill potential nutritional gaps.
-
Consider Supplementation: While a balanced diet is ideal, supplements can serve as an insurance policy. A B12 supplement is often recommended for those with limited intake from fish, dairy, or eggs. Fish oil supplements are another option for boosting omega-3 intake if you don't eat enough fatty fish.
-
Don't Forget the Sun: Sensible sun exposure is a crucial part of vitamin D production for everyone, including pescetarians.

How can pescetarians boost calcium intake without dairy?
- Calcium-set Tofu: A half-cup serving of tofu prepared with calcium sulfate can provide significant calcium.
- Canned Fish with Bones: Canned salmon and sardines with bones are excellent sources of calcium.
- Fortified Plant Milks: Many soy, almond, and oat milks are fortified with calcium.
- Leafy Greens: Kale and bok choy provide highly absorbable calcium.
- Seeds: Chia and sesame seeds are rich in calcium.
- Figs: Both fresh and dried figs offer a notable amount of calcium.
How can pescetarians balance omega-3 intake with mercury concerns?
- Choose Lower-Mercury Fish: Prioritize smaller, lower-mercury fish like salmon, sardines, herring, and trout.
- Limit Higher-Mercury Fish: Reduce consumption of larger predatory fish such as swordfish and king mackerel.
- Rotate Fish Types: Varying the types of fish consumed helps to diversify nutrient intake while managing mercury exposure.
Why is heme iron from red meat more easily absorbed than non-heme iron from plants?
- Heme iron, found in animal products like red meat, has a higher bioavailability and absorption rate because it is not significantly affected by other dietary components. Non-heme iron from plant sources is more sensitive to inhibitors like phytates and oxalates.
